INFORMATION PROVIDED WITH THE PHOTO
  • date of photo  Sep 5, 2008
  • latitude 27.61098   longitude 107.55630     View on Google Maps.
  • location   grounds, Sierra Lodge, 0.2 mi. west of State Hiway 25, 12.5 miles south of Creel, near Cusarare (Mcp. Guachochi, Chihuahua, Mexico)
  • family Onagraceae
  • plant community   river riparian corrider in pine-oak woodland at 2193m (7195')
  • notes   among grazed grasses in moist soil around small seep on banks of the Rio Cusarare in front of Lodge. Volcanic tuff substrate.
